Xavier Vancassel


Dr Xavier Vancassel (PhD University of Strasbourg, 2003), currently heads the Engine Emissions and Environmental Impact research unit at ONERA, the French Aerospace Lab, in the Fundamental and Applied Energetics Department. He has been working on aviation emissions related projects since 2000. As a specialist in aircraft produced aerosol and atmospheric impact, he has been involved in many EU projects like PartEmis (2000-2003), on gas turbine particulate emissions, QUANTIFY (2005-2010), on aircraft near-field plume processes, in ECATS (2005-2010), SWAFEA (2009-2011) on alternative fuels for aviation, and more recently on FORUM-AE. He also coordinated national funded projects. His main research interests are nucleation processes in aircraft plumes, plume processes modelling, alternative fuel impacts and soot particle emission measurements.
